A Graduate Certificate in Environmental Chemical Engineering provides specialized training in applying chemical engineering principles to environmental challenges. This focused program equips students with advanced knowledge and practical skills in areas like pollution prevention, remediation, and sustainable technologies.
Learning outcomes typically include proficiency in environmental modeling, waste management strategies, and the design of sustainable chemical processes. Graduates develop expertise in risk assessment, regulatory compliance, and the application of advanced analytical techniques relevant to environmental monitoring and analysis. The curriculum often incorporates hands-on projects and case studies to foster practical application of learned concepts.
The duration of a Graduate Certificate in Environmental Chemical Engineering program varies, generally ranging from 9 to 18 months of full-time study, depending on the institution and specific course requirements. Part-time options are frequently available, extending the program's length accordingly.
This certificate holds significant industry relevance. Graduates are well-prepared for careers in environmental consulting, industrial process improvement, regulatory agencies, and research institutions. The skills acquired are highly sought after in sectors focused on sustainability, pollution control, and environmental protection, making it a valuable credential for professionals seeking career advancement or a change in specialization within the chemical engineering or environmental science fields. Water quality management, air pollution control, and hazardous waste management are just some of the areas where this certification proves beneficial.
The program's strong focus on sustainable engineering practices aligns with global demands for environmentally conscious solutions and positions graduates to contribute meaningfully to a more sustainable future. The acquired knowledge in advanced treatment technologies and life cycle assessment further enhance their employability.
